    Some of the best Indian food I've had! The people were so nice as well. It's a small restaurant inside an Indian grocery store so don't get discouraged when you walk in. The guy at the register was so nice and answered all my questions I had about different menu items. I got garlic naan, palak paner, chicken briyani, butter chicken and samosas. It was enough food to last me 3 meals! Everything was amazing. I definitely recommend coming here. All this food cost me about $40-$50. Definitely worth it in my opinion

    Food was so good. It's takeout only inside a grocery store. Texted me when my order was ready. Had garlic naan, chicken 65 biryani, and butter chicken. Actually ended up 3 meals for me. I'll be back soon!
